How does Utah's unique school choice legislation, like the Utah Fits All Scholarship, benefit Dutch John families considering private schools?
Utah's recently enacted Utah Fits All Scholarship program is a significant financial consideration. This state-funded education savings account provides approximately $8,000 per student (amount subject to annual funding) that can be used for private school tuition, tutoring, curricula, and other approved educational services. For a Dutch John family facing long commutes to a Vernal-based private school, these funds can help offset not only tuition but also transportation costs, making a private school option more financially feasible. Eligibility is based on state residency and income, with priority for lower-income families.

What is the enrollment process and timeline like for private schools in Vernal, and how should Dutch John families plan for the logistical challenges?
Enrollment for schools like Ashley Valley Christian Academy and St. Joseph's typically opens in early spring (February-March) for the following fall, with rolling admissions until spots are filled. The process involves an application, family interview, academic records review, and often a placement assessment. For Dutch John families, the critical added steps are logistical: planning for the 70+ mile one-way commute, which may involve coordinating with other families for carpooling or exploring mid-week boarding arrangements. It's highly recommended to initiate contact with the school admissions office almost a full year in advance to discuss your specific situation, tour the campus, and understand transportation solutions other remote families have used.
